Daily Responsibilities of a Pharmacy Technician

Understanding core tasks helps you decide if this role matches your interests and strengths.

  • Processing prescriptions and verifying insurance details
  • Measuring medications and labeling containers accurately
  • Communicating with pharmacists, patients, and healthcare providers
  • Maintaining inventory, handling returns, and following safety rules

Online and Hybrid Program Formats

Many pharmacy technician programs near me offer online theory with local clinical components.

Flexible Scheduling

Hybrid models let you study evenings or weekends while completing required hours at nearby pharmacies.

Technology Requirements

Expect reliable internet, a webcam, simulation software, and secure logins for patient case modules.

FAQ

Reader questions

How long does it take to complete a local pharmacy technician program?

Most programs range from 5 months to 1 year, depending on full-time or part-time enrollment and whether you include externship hours.

Do I need a high school diploma or GED to enroll?

Yes, programs typically require a high school diploma or GED, and some also ask for basic math and reading assessments.

Will I be prepared for the PTCB exam after finishing the course?

Yes, quality pharmacy technician programs include topic reviews and practice exams aligned with PTCB content areas.

Can I work while taking pharmacy technician classes near me?

Many hybrid and evening programs allow you to work, but you should plan for scheduled externships that may require daytime presence.
